Here is footage taken by my late grandfather, Jim Millar, of Bangor Co. Down in the 50s and 60s when he was involved with the Bangor Tourist Association. He supplied much of the footage for the BBC's THE DAY WE WENT TO BANGOR. I have edited out the bits that are only of interest to my family.
